This coconut flavored rice with crispy garlic is super easy to make and goes really well as an accompaniment to any Asian inspired main dish. The toasted garlic and coconut oil give the rice a lovely aromatic flavor without being overwhelming.
Coconut Rice with Crispy Garlic
Ingredients:
- 1 cup Basmati rice or any white rice of your choice
- 4-6 cloves garlic finely chopped
- 1 tsp salt
- 2 tbsp coconut oil
- 1 tbsp unsweetened shredded coconut (optional)
Directions:
- Bring 3 cups water to a boil. Add rice and a pinch of salt. Stir the rice and lower the heat. Cook covered for 10 minutes until rice is cooked through and tender.
- In another pot heat coconut oil and sauté garlic until slightly browned and crisp. Do this without burning the garlic. Add shredded coconut if using and cooked rice and mix into the garlic oil. Taste for salt and adjust accordingly. Rice is ready.
- Fluff rice with a fork before serving.
